聚焦于对区块链真实核心技术的探寻,意在通过深入了解其关键技术,挖掘其重塑未来的潜力,区块链作为新兴技术,核心技术中蕴含着极大的革新力量,对于诸多行业的结构与模式可能带来深远影响,探寻其核心技术,不仅有助于我们把握区块链的本质特性,更利于借助其赋能实体经济,在金融、供应链等领域引发变革,进而成为推动未来社会、经济等多方面发展的重要驱动力。
在当今这个数字化浪潮如汹涌波涛般席卷全球的时代,区块链技术宛如夜空中一颗冉冉升起、璀璨夺目的新星,吸引着无数探索者的目光,从金融领域不断涌现的创新应用,为传统金融体系注入新的活力,到供应链管理的深度优化,让商品流通的每一个环节都更加透明高效;从医疗数据的安全共享,为患者的健康保障增添一道坚实防线,到艺术作品的版权保护,让创作者的智慧结晶得到妥善守护,区块链的身影可谓无处不在,渗透到了社会生活的方方面面,在众多的炒作和概念包装之下,我们更需要以严谨的态度、科学的方法深入探寻区块链真实的核心技术,了解其本质,如此方能真正把握这一技术带来的变革机遇,在时代的浪潮中勇立潮头。
分布式账本技术:区块链的基石
分布式账本堪称区块链最基础也是最核心的技术之一,传统的账本通常由单一的中心化机构进行管理和维护,这就如同将所有鸡蛋放在一个篮子里,存在单点故障和数据篡改的巨大风险,一旦这个中心化机构出现问题,如遭受黑客攻击、内部人员违规操作等,整个账本的数据安全将受到严重威胁,可能导致数据丢失、被篡改等严重后果,进而影响到与之相关的各种业务和交易。
而分布式账本则采用了一种截然不同的方式,它将账本数据分散存储在网络中的多个节点上,每个节点都保存着一份完整或部分的账本副本,这种分散式的存储结构就像一个庞大而精密的拼图,每个节点都是拼图的一部分,共同构成了一个完整的账本体系,以比特币为例,比特币的区块链就是一个典型的分布式账本,在比特币网络中,每一笔交易都会被详细记录在一个区块中,然后通过先进的密码学算法将这些区块像链条一样紧密地链接起来,形成一个不可分割的整体,网络中的每个节点都可以积极参与到交易的验证和记账过程中,只有当大部分节点达成共识后,这笔交易才会被确认并正式记录到账本中,这种分布式的记账方式使得账本数据具有高度的安全性和不可篡改性,因为任何试图篡改数据的行为都需要同时控制网络中超过半数的节点,这在实际操作中几乎是不可能完成的任务,就像要同时掌控一个庞大军队的大部分士兵一样困难。
分布式账本技术的应用不仅局限于加密货币领域,在供应链管理中,通过分布式账本可以实现对商品从生产到销售全过程的信息记录和跟踪,每个环节的参与者,如原材料供应商、生产商、物流商、零售商等,都可以将相关信息写入账本,形成一个完整的商品信息链条,消费者可以通过扫描商品上的二维码轻松查询商品的详细信息,包括原材料来源、生产工艺、运输过程等,从而提高供应链的透明度和可信度,让消费者能够更加放心地购买商品。
共识机制:确保网络一致性
共识机制是区块链网络中节点之间达成一致意见的规则和算法,由于区块链网络是一个去中心化的网络,节点之间可能来自不同的组织或个人,它们之间没有天然的信任基础,就像一群陌生人在一个陌生的环境中交流合作一样,需要一种科学合理的机制来确保所有节点对账本数据的一致性,保证整个网络的正常运行。
常见的共识机制有工作量证明(PoW)、权益证明(PoS)、委托权益证明(DPoS)等,工作量证明是比特币采用的共识机制,节点需要通过计算复杂的数学难题来竞争记账权,这就像一场激烈的竞赛,只有第一个解出难题的节点才能将新的区块添加到区块链中,并获得相应的奖励,这种机制虽然在很大程度上保证了网络的安全性,使得攻击者难以轻易篡改数据,但也存在能耗高、效率低的问题,大量的计算需要消耗巨额的电力资源,同时解题的过程也需要一定的时间,导致交易确认的速度较慢。
权益证明则是根据节点持有的代币数量来分配记账权,持有代币越多的节点获得记账权的概率越大,这种机制相对工作量证明来说能耗较低,效率也更高,它就像一个基于财富的选举制度,拥有更多财富(代币)的节点在网络决策中具有更大的话语权,委托权益证明是在权益证明的基础上发展而来的,节点可以通过投票选举出一定数量的代表节点来负责记账,这样可以进一步提高网络的效率,这类似于民主选举,通过选举代表来集中处理事务,减少了不必要的决策过程,提高了整体的运行效率。
不同的共识机制适用于不同的场景,在公有链中,由于参与者众多且匿名性强,需要采用安全性较高的共识机制,如工作量证明或权益证明,以确保网络的安全和稳定,而在联盟链中,由于参与者是经过授权的,信任度相对较高,可以采用效率更高的共识机制,如委托权益证明,以提高业务处理的速度和效率。
智能合约:自动化的合约执行
智能合约是一种以代码形式编写的合约,它就像一个不知疲倦的机器人,能够自动执行合约中的条款和条件,智能合约运行在区块链上,一旦满足预设的条件,合约就会自动触发执行,无需人工干预,这种自动化的执行方式不仅提高了效率,还减少了人为因素的干扰,保证了合约执行的公正性和准确性。
以保险行业为例,传统的保险理赔过程往往需要投保人提交大量的证明材料,经过保险公司繁琐的审核流程后才能获得赔偿,这个过程不仅繁琐且耗时,还容易受到人为因素的影响,如审核人员的主观判断、信息传递的误差等,而通过智能合约,可以将保险条款以代码的形式精确地写入区块链中,当发生保险事故时,相关的传感器或数据来源会将事故信息自动上传到区块链上,智能合约会根据预设的条件自动判断是否符合理赔标准,如果符合,则自动将赔偿款支付给投保人,整个过程快速、准确、透明,这样不仅提高了理赔的效率,还减少了人为因素的干扰,降低了欺诈风险,让保险服务更加可靠和便捷。
智能合约的应用还可以拓展到房地产、金融交易、知识产权保护等多个领域,在房地产交易中,智能合约可以自动完成房屋产权的转移和资金的支付,确保交易的安全和透明,它就像一个公正的第三方,严格按照合约条款执行每一个步骤,避免了传统交易中可能出现的纠纷和风险,在金融交易中,智能合约可以实现自动清算和结算,提高交易的效率和准确性,让金融市场的运行更加顺畅。
密码学技术:保障数据安全
密码学技术是区块链技术的重要组成部分,它为区块链的数据安全提供了坚实的保障,在区块链中,密码学技术主要应用于数据加密、身份验证和数字签名等方面。
数据加密是将敏感数据转换为密文的过程,只有拥有正确密钥的人才能解密并获取原始数据,在区块链中,交易数据和用户信息通常会采用对称加密或非对称加密算法进行加密,确保数据在传输和存储过程中的安全性,对称加密就像一把钥匙开一把锁,加密和解密使用相同的密钥;非对称加密则使用一对密钥,一个公钥和一个私钥,公钥用于加密,私钥用于解密,这种方式更加安全可靠,通过加密技术,即使数据在传输过程中被截取,攻击者也无法获取其中的敏感信息,从而保护了用户的隐私和数据安全。
身份验证是确认用户身份的过程,在区块链网络中,节点需要通过身份验证才能参与到网络的交易和记账过程中,常用的身份验证方式有基于公钥密码学的数字证书和基于生物特征识别的身份验证,数字证书就像一个电子身份证,它包含了用户的公钥和相关的身份信息,通过数字证书可以验证用户的身份真实性,生物特征识别则利用人体的生物特征,如指纹、面部识别、虹膜识别等,来确认用户的身份,这种方式更加安全、便捷,能够有效防止身份冒用和欺诈行为。
数字签名是一种用于验证数据完整性和真实性的技术,在区块链中,用户在进行交易时会使用自己的私钥对交易数据进行签名,其他节点可以使用用户的公钥来验证签名的有效性,如果签名有效,则说明交易数据没有被篡改,并且确实是由该用户发起的,数字签名就像一个独特的印章,它确保了交易的真实性和不可抵赖性,为区块链网络中的交易提供了可靠的保障。
区块链真实的核心技术——分布式账本技术、共识机制、智能合约和密码学技术,它们相互协作、相互补充,就像一个精密的机器中的各个零部件,共同构建了一个安全、透明、高效的去中心化网络,这些技术的应用不仅为各个行业带来了创新和变革的机遇,也为解决传统互联网中的信任问题提供了新的思路和方法。
区块链技术目前仍处于发展阶段,还面临着性能、可扩展性、监管等方面的挑战,在性能方面,区块链网络的交易处理速度还无法满足大规模商业应用的需求;在可扩展性方面,随着节点数量的增加和数据量的增大,区块链网络的运行效率可能会受到影响;在监管方面,由于区块链的去中心化特点,给传统的监管模式带来了新的挑战,但随着技术的不断进步和完善,区块链真实的核心技术将在更多的领域得到应用,为我们的社会和经济发展带来深远的影响,我们需要以理性和客观的态度去认识和研究区块链技术,充分发挥其优势,积极应对挑战,推动其健康、可持续的发展,让区块链技术真正成为推动社会进步的强大动力。
标签: #核心技术